Description

We are seeking a Restaurant Director responsible for leading, coordinating, and elevating the customer’s gastronomic experience to the highest level of excellence—ensuring impeccable service through leadership of the front-of-house team, meticulous attention to detail, and creation of memorable experiences. The primary objective of this position is to maintain and reinforce the restaurant’s three Michelin stars by delivering flawless front-of-house service that guarantees consistent excellence in every service, exceeds customer expectations, and fosters loyalty through personalized, elegant treatment. Additionally, the Restaurant Director must develop a highly professional, cohesive, and committed front-of-house team and ensure effective coordination between front-of-house and kitchen to guarantee fluidity, precision, and coherence across the entire guest experience. Key responsibilities: * Lead, train, and motivate the front-of-house team, establishing clear workflows. * Evaluate team performance and foster a culture of excellence, respect, and continuous improvement. * Ensure personalized, elegant, and seamless service from welcome to farewell. * Supervise service for VIP guests, gastronomic critics, and specialized press. * Anticipate customer needs and manage expectations with discretion and sensitivity. * Resolve incidents or complaints immediately, professionally, and empathetically. * Ensure absolute consistency in the team’s communication regarding dishes, techniques, and culinary philosophy. * Serve as the strategic liaison between front-of-house and kitchen, ensuring smooth communication on timing, allergens, preferences, and last-minute changes. * Monitor standards of protocol, etiquette, and body language. * Guarantee adherence to service timing. * Supervise reservations, table assignments, and optimal dining room rotation. * Ensure the dining room is in perfect condition (lighting, acoustics, cleanliness, and temperature). * Supervise high-level wine and beverage service. * Conduct ongoing audits of service quality. * Analyze customer and critic feedback to drive continuous improvement. Requirements: * Native or near-native proficiency in Spanish and English; knowledge of additional languages is a plus. * Prior experience in high-end gastronomic restaurants. * Exceptional attention to detail, strong leadership abilities, and outstanding communication skills.
